Book Synopsis

The Practical Peacemaker shows how compassionate people concerned about violence, inequity, and environmental destruction can, by living simply, transform their lives into an effective statement for peace. Everyday choices, if arising from ethical intention, can make a substantial difference. Written especially for those who have despaired of being able to make any meaningful response, The Practical Peacemaker empowers as it outlines a broader vision than has been articulated by previous books on simple living. To become peacemakers, we need to pay as much attention to what is happening in our thinking as we do to downsizing our budget or clearing our clutter. The book examines such peace-destroying personal habits as careless eating and drinking, overbusy schedules, seeking instant gratification, and anger. It goes on to consider societal obstacles to peace, such as advertising, media saturation, rudeness, prejudice, environmental degradation, and overpopulation. At both the personal and societal levels, readers are shown specific positive actions they can take, without waiting for others to change, which will further the cause of peace in themselves and in the world.
